High alumina bricks for waste incinerators are used to build the inner lining of waste incinerators, and the inner lining can also be built with clay bricks and silicon carbide bricks.
Column 1 |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|
AL2O3 (%) | 75 | 65 | 55 | 85 |
Fe203 (%) | 2.5 | 2.5 | 2.6 | 2 |
Bulk density g/cm³ | 2.5 | 2.4 | 2.3 | 2 |
Normal temperature compressive strength MPa | 70 | 60 | 50 | 80 |
Load softening temperature ℃ | 1510 | 1460 | 1420 | 1550 |
Refractoriness ℃ | 1790 | 1770 | 1770 | 1790 |
Apparent porosity (%) | 22 | 23 | 24 | 21 |
line rate of change (%) | -0.3 | -0.4 | -0.4 | -0.2 |
